Index of /upload/product/112957
Name
Last modified
Size
Description
Parent Directory
-
c82c9db4ebebf0d7ba8f..>
2015-08-14 12:42
8.7K
c82c9db4ebebf0d7ba8f..>
2015-08-14 12:42
27K